CPI Aerostructures Revenue

In the year 2025, CPI Aerostructures had annual revenue of $69.26M, down -14.57%. CPI Aerostructures had revenue of $19.41M in the quarter ending December 31, 2025, a decrease of -10.82%.

Revenue History

Fiscal Year EndRevenueChangeGrowth
Dec 31, 202569.26M-11.82M-14.57%
Dec 31, 202481.08M-5.39M-6.23%
Dec 31, 202386.47M3.13M3.76%
Dec 31, 202283.34M-20.03M-19.38%
Dec 31, 2021103.37M15.78M18.02%
Dec 31, 202087.58M66.00K0.08%
Dec 31, 201987.52M17.15M24.38%
Dec 31, 201870.37M-10.92M-13.43%
Dec 31, 201781.28M-46.71K-0.06%
Dec 31, 201681.33M-18.87M-18.83%
Dec 31, 2015100.20M60.52M152.48%
Dec 31, 201439.69M-43.30M-52.18%
Dec 31, 201382.99M-6.28M-7.04%
Dec 31, 201289.27M15.14M20.42%
Dec 31, 201174.14M30.14M68.53%
Dec 31, 201043.99M83.96K0.19%
Dec 31, 200943.91M8.32M23.37%
Dec 31, 200835.59M7.60M27.17%
Dec 31, 200727.99M10.08M56.27%
Dec 31, 200617.91M-7.62M-29.85%
Dec 31, 200525.53M--

Revenue Definition

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
